Zanzibar City’s historic heart, Stone Town, is a UNESCO World Heritage site that feels like a living museum. To truly grasp its soul, a private walking tour is essential, guiding you through narrow, winding alleys past intricately carved wooden doors and bustling bazaars. Key highlights include the Old Fort and the House of Wonders, where the island’s rich fusion of Arab, Persian, Indian, and European influences comes to life. As evening falls, the Forodhani Gardens transform into a vibrant night market, offering a legendary foodie walk filled with local seafood and Zanzibar pizzas.
Beyond the limestone corridors, the surrounding area offers sensory and natural adventures. A visit to a local spice farm reveals why this is known as the Spice Island, as you touch, smell, and taste fresh cloves, nutmeg, and cinnamon. Nearby, a short boat ride leads to Prison Island, home to giant Aldabra tortoises and a poignant history. For those seeking the perfect blend of sand and sea, excursions to Nakupenda Beach provide a pristine sandbank experience, while the nearby waters offer world-class snorkeling and dolphin sightings.
